How they compare
Russia currently reports 106 against 92 in Hong Kong, a difference of 14.
That makes Russia's figure about 1.2 times Hong Kong's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 17 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Hong Kong ahead.
Hong Kong ranks 42nd and Russia ranks 40th of 121 countries.
Russia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Hong Kong | Russia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 9.14 | 30.86 | 21.71 | Russia |
| 2010s | 36.67 | 176.5 | 139.83 | Russia |
| 2020s | 73.25 | 217 | 143.75 | Russia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
